  • Question: How do I properly use the Boride sharpening stone?

    Answer: To use the Boride sharpening stone, first ensure the stone is securely mounted on an Edge Pro system. Wet the stone with water to reduce friction and prevent clogging. Then, position your blade at the optimal angle and make consistent, sweeping strokes along the stone, applying even pressure. This method allows for uniform sharpening while maintaining the blade’s integrity. Regularly check the edge during the process, and finish with a light polish for a razor-sharp result, perfect for any cutting task you encounter.

  • Question: Can I use the Boride sharpening stone dry?

    Answer: While the Boride sharpening stone can be used dry, it is highly recommended to use it wet with water for best results. Wet sharpening reduces friction, prevents stone clogging, and facilitates smoother blade movement. Using the stone dry may result in uneven sharpening and increased wear on the stone. For optimal performance and to achieve the sharpest edge possible, always soak the stone or keep it wet during the sharpening process.

  • Question: What maintenance does the Boride sharpening stone require?

    Answer: Maintaining the Boride sharpening stone is straightforward. After each use, simply rinse it with water to remove metal shavings and debris, and let it air dry. Regularly checking for flatness can help maintain its performance; if it becomes uneven, flatten it with a diamond plate. By keeping it clean and ensuring a flat surface, the stone retains its cutting efficacy and extends its lifespan, providing users reliable performance whenever needed.
